Midweek internationals performances‏

Aleksandar Vasoski (L) reacts during the cup game vs AlemanniaEintracht Frankfurt and Aleksandar Vasoski were eliminated from the German Cup, while Neftçi with Igor Mitreski and Slavco Georgievski finished on 1st place in the top Azerbaijani league at the end of the first half of the season.

Germany, DFB-Pokal, Alemannia Aachen – Eintracht Frankfurt 1:1  (Alemannia Aachen advanced 5:3 on penalties)
Aleksandar Vasoski played all 120 minutes for Eintracht Frankfurt and also picked up a yellow card in the 117th minute while his teammate Oka Nikolov was not called up because of an injury.  This game was tied at 0:0 after 90 minutes so it went into extra time where both teams scored a goal and it went into penalty kicks.  Alemannia Aachen went first and converted all five penalties while Alexander Meier had the decisive miss for Eintracht when his penalty went over the goal in the rainy conditions which meant Eintracht was eliminated from the German Cup.  As a matter of fact, Alemannia Aachen from the German second division was also the team that eliminated Mainz in the previous round of the German Cup so they eliminated the teams of both Nikolce Noveski and Aleksandar Vasoski.

Azerbaijan, Unibank Premyer Liqası, Neftçi – Turan Tovuz 2:0
Both Igor Mitreski and Slavco Georgievski played the entire game for Neftçi who returned to their winning ways at home after their last home game resulted in a surprising 2:0 loss to FK Bakı.  This game concluded the first half of the season in Azerbaijan and Neftçi is currently in 1st place with 41 points after 19 rounds.

Azerbaijan, Unibank Premyer Liqası, Muğan – AZAL 3:1
Sasko Pandev
started for Muğan and played until the 62nd minute when he was replaced by Ravi Rahmanov while Robert Petrov played all 90 minutes for AZAL who took the lead in the 8th minute before Muğan scored three consecutive goals to record the victory.

Netherlands, KNVB Beker, Roda – PSV Eindhoven 1:3
Yani Urdinov was an unused substitute for Roda while his teammates Aleksandar Stankov and Antonio Stankov were not called up as their team was eliminated from the Dutch Cup.

Saudi Arabia, Zain Saudi League, Al-Nassr – Al-Taawon 2:2
Mensur Kurtisi started for Al-Taawon and played until the 70th minute when he was replaced by Hussain Al-Shehri.  Kurtisi also picked up a yellow card in the 1st minute.
